According to the public record, 40, Peterborough Drive, Bootle is a mid-century freehold house with 904 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 215 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 40, Peterborough Drive, Bootle is £136,395 and the estimated rental value is £1,013 per month.
Peterborough Drive, Bootle, L30 is located in the borough of Sefton within the L30 postal district.
40, Peterborough Drive, Bootle has 41 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in November 2017 and a single entry in the EPC database dated April 2017.
We combine this information with that of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 4 out of 5 and is considered of high accuracy.
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 40, Peterborough Drive, Bootle is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£143,215 and a rental value of £1,064 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£126,847 and a rental value of £942 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 40 Peterborough Drive Bootle has increased by an estimated £4,724 (3.5%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£45 per month (4.4%), giving an expected gross yield of 8.9%.

40, Peterborough Drive, Bootle has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 12 Apr 2017.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 40, Peterborough Drive, Bootle was last sold on 27th November 2017 for £82,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 4 sales since 1995.
